Ledo and Julen sign the triumph of Bidasoa Irun

The goalkeeper stopped fifteen balls in Santander and the pivot scored the last four goals for his team

Bidasoa Irun beat Unicaja Banco Sinfín 22-26 yesterday and strengthens its second position with 30 points to 28 from Granollers and 24 from Logroño. The three have already played against Barça and a third of the competition remains, in which the two European places left free by the Catalan team and the runner-up will be decided. Coming out of the marathon of matches but still with its aftermath in the legs and in the number of troops, the irundarra team appeared without Azkue, Salinas or Kauldi and with five players from the subsidiary in Santander, where the third-last classified awaited. The need for Sinfín and their good work at home predicted a complicated game for Cuétara’s men, who once again gave the youngsters many minutes, obtaining good responses from them.

For example, Mujika, who scored two of the goals in the initial 0-4. With 100% in their attacks and good defense and goalkeeping, the yellow team laid a good base in less than four minutes, but the local timeout reactivated their defense above all and the duel was balanced. Of course, the equality that was seen on the field was not reflected in the scoreboard, thanks to that advantage of four goals that the Gipuzkoans had claimed in the blink of an eye.

Except for 2-5, the difference was always 3-4 goals until it widened in the final stretch of the first half. From 7-10 it went to 8-14 and at half-time it was 9-14. The result could be reminiscent of what happened last season on this court, but then the first half ended with a 7-17 that left the game doomed (it ended 16-34) and yesterday five goals were good but not definitive.

Cantabrian reaction

The clash resumed with a local and partial serve of 3-0 that led to Cuétara’s timeout. Although it took him five minutes to score his first goal from a penalty and almost nine minutes for his first on play, Bidasoa resolved the first Cantabrian onslaught with an identical partial, so the five goals came back at 12-17. And they were still there ten minutes later, when Gey-Emparan scored 17-22.

There were eleven minutes left and the yellows had the upper hand, but it was still going to be difficult for them to achieve their victory. El Sinfín drew another 3-0 run in five minutes and came back within two, 20-22. He even had a fast break to get within one, but lost the ball.

The game was alive and Bidasoa Irun, not so much. One thing is that February and the match marathon have passed, but the deposit is in reserve and with that the points were still up in the air.

Perhaps when all – the eleven of the first team and the five of the reserve team – have given so much it is unfair to single out one or two players, but yesterday Xoan Ledo and Julen Aginagalde stood out. The goalkeeper made 15 saves (two from penalties) and two of them were key with three up. And the pivot scored the four goals of the 1-4 run that sentenced the clash (from 20-22 to 21-26), to passes from Nieto, Rodríguez and Fernández and the fourth picking up a rebound.

Two games and break

With that point of intrigue and emotion in the final stretch, victory tastes better to a Bidasoa Irun who will play the last match of the European league on Tuesday at the Toulouse stadium and on Sunday will host Ademar. Then the break will come for the national team matches, which will be very welcome by the Bidasotarra squad.

Before, today, the people of Gipuzkoa will know the table of the final phase of the Copa del Rey, which will be played from March 25 to 27 in Antequera and which will be drawn today in Madrid.
